I can think of better things to change than the name

Change the rule that you cannot get a promotion to a higher grade licence for a Clerk... unless you officiate at a higher grade meeting....which you cant do ... unless you belong to the "inner circle" of bigger clubs

Change the way that the module training is done (it dates back to the 50's ) for becoming a clerk, put in place exams and tasks that need to assessed and marked etc rather than it being "signed off" in a book that is a photocopy

Help promote younger clubs to get more content by way of younger competitors but more over YOUNGER OFFICIALS... as they are getting fewer and fewer

Changing the name makes it sound like a webpage or a magazine, its not, its supposed to be the organisation responsible for Motorsport governance
